
Embracing Freedom: The Journey to Trusting Your Body
For many, the idea of stepping away from counting macros feels daunting, yet the journey toward intuitive eating leads to freedom and self-trust. Dr. Gabrielle Fundaro, with her extensive background in nutrition, highlights the emotional struggle many face when trying to rely on internal cues. After years of strict macro tracking, she realized that this method, which once provided structure and accountability, had turned restrictive and draining. Instead of feeling empowered, she became anxious about her food choices.
Macro Tracking: The Double-Edged Sword
Tracking macros can be a beneficial tool for some, but it often creates an unhealthy relationship with food. As Dr. Fundaro experienced, constant monitoring led to fear: “What if I don’t eat enough protein?”or “What if I gain fat?” These worries plague those who feel they need to maintain control through numbers. Learning to let go of this rigidity is essential for true progress in a healthier mindset.
The Birth of RPE-Eating: A Balanced Approach
Inspired by her training methods, Dr. Fundaro developed the RPE-Eating Scale, a unique alternative where individuals can gauge their food intake with mindfulness rather than rigid metrics. By adopting a similar philosophy used in strength training, this approach encourages users to listen to their body's signals, providing a structured yet flexible framework for dietary choices.
How RPE-Eating Works: A Step-by-Step Guide
Implementing RPE-Eating begins with understanding your hunger and satiety cues. Start by rating your hunger on a scale from 1-10 before and after meals, allowing you to connect physical sensations with food intake. Create meal guidelines based on how you feel post-mealtime instead of nutritional math, helping to naturally regulate portion sizes without strict counting.
The Benefits of Trusting Your Instincts Around Food
Learning to trust your instincts around food not only helps in maintaining a healthy weight but also elevates your overall relationship with food. Science suggests that a highly restrictive diet can lead to binging behaviors, while RPE-Eating fosters a more relaxed environment. This method also encourages individuals to experiment with different foods, enhancing their overall culinary repertoire.
Common Misconceptions About Eating Without Tracking
A prevalent myth is that stepping away from strict tracking will result in immediate weight gain or loss of muscle. However, RPE-Eating allows individuals to tune into their bodies’ needs and make adjustments accordingly. Many experience surprising benefits in muscle maintenance and energy levels after adopting this method.
